LR updates rules to cover wind propulsion and crew safety
Lloyd’s Register (LR) has unveiled significant updates to its classification standards, designed to advance the adoption of wind propulsion technologies and elevate crew safety at sea. These new regulations, announced this week, are scheduled to come into effect on January 1, 2026.
Key among the revisions are the introduction of specialized technical notations for Wind-Assisted Propulsion Systems (WAPS and WAPS*), alongside new provisions for ergonomic design (EASE). These additions aim to provide clear guidelines and support for the integration of sustainable propulsion methods and enhance the well-being of seafarers. LR has also refined other aspects of its framework to address evolving industry needs.
